Paralegal Studies
LAW X 406
Paralegal Training Program
36.0 units UCLA Extension’s Paralegal Training Program (PTP) is approved by the American Bar Association and seeks to prepare students to function as ethical, effective, and efficient professional paralegals in law firms, businesses, government, and nonprofit organizations; to perform a wide variety of legal work under the supervision of attorneys; and to adapt easily to the changing role of the paralegal as well as the chang‑ ing needs of the legal community. The PTP provides training in sub‑ stantive and procedural law, legal analysis, professional responsibility, legal forms, legal technology, and practical skills needed to work in the public or private sector as a competent and professional paralegal. This program fulfills educational requirements to practice as a para‑ legal in California. Instructors for the program are approved by the UCLA School of Law and include judges, attorneys, paralegals, and other legal professionals. Assistance in career counseling and job search opportunities are available to current students and program graduates. Paralegals may not provide legal services directly to the public, except as permitted by law. Lifetime placement assistance is available to PTP graduates. Pursuant to ABA Guidelines, students must take at least nine‑semester credits or the equivalent of legal specialty courses through synchronous instruction. Law X 406 Paralegal Train‑ ing Program meets this requirement.

LAW X 407.1
Oral Communication and Presentation Skills for Legal and Business Professionals
1.0 units This course provides a foundational summary of the manner in which to approach oral business communications, from informal one‑on‑one status reports to formal business presentations for larger audiences. It also covers how to communicate during meetings with colleagues and clients. Topics include understanding your objective; selecting the appropriate tone for the audience; preparation, including knowl‑ edge acquisition, time management, and validation of information; selecting supporting materials; handling questions; post presentation communication; and self‑assessment.

LAW X 420
Business Law: Fundamentals
4.0 units This course explores the legal environment in which businesses oper‑ ate and the critical interaction between business and the legal system. Students examine various areas of the law which are integral to the operation of business enterprises today. Topics include contracts, torts, agency, Uniform Commercial Code, bankruptcy, and the different forms of business entities. Business owners, managers, accountants, para‑ legals, and all those seeking to enrich their general understanding of the legal system can benefit from this course. Business Law: Funde‑ mentals also prepares students for the legal section of the CPA Exam.
